Output 50c62ae5a9939cc0a040ef5199a0502bc49e2589fbecc2b75be77512002123cd:5

value
42441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4fd8662ff1a2640825adaa6ffdded53dad7a8aa OP_EQUAL
address
3Kec5N7BZ2gGHmuqV4hmFFtKDXzp4z2pLp
transaction
50c62ae5a9939cc0a040ef5199a0502bc49e2589fbecc2b75be77512002123cd
spent
true